Who is poor?
In response to the concept of "poor", we must first understand what poverty is manifested in certain aspects, the criteria and standards to identify and assess the level of poverty, the poor state of the U.S. in recent years , the factors that affect poverty.
"Standard" Poverty is defined by U.S. government based on some rules of the poverty of the United Nations (UN): 2000-2006 period, household income per capita in the rural domain mountains and islands from 80,000 VND / person / month or less as poor, rural delta is 100,000 VND / person / month, the market is 150,000 VND / person / month.
Prime Minister's Decision No. 170/2005/QD-TTg dated 08/7/2005 government "Promulgating the poverty line applicable for the period 2006 to 2010": Rural areas, households with income troops from 200,000 VND / person / month (2.4 million VND / person / year) or less is poor. Urban areas: from 260,000 VND / person / month (less than 3,120,000 VND / person / year) or less is poor.
Estimated poverty line for the period 2010-2015: The market is 812,500 VND / person / month, 562,500 VND in rural / person / month.
Poor households in Vietnam, most of the ethnic minority areas and remote areas of border islands, mountainous areas. Farmers in rural areas, especially the little arable land, or natural disasters. The employees, retirees, or small business ....
Also in urban areas, the urban poor class, living in the house "ghetto", or suburb. The main income of the poor are from rural aquaculture farming, forestry, fisheries, accounting for 55.5% of total income, wages accounted for 23.8% of the total wage income.
Little income, it must prioritize spending for basic needs to sustain life such as buying food, fuel ... always accounted for the highest rate, to 65.1%. And more to the needs for quality of life such as housing, electricity, water, sanitation, health, education, entertainment ... accounted for only 34.9%.
Thus, when prices rise, the poor will have only incremental earnings to sustain life, such as to increase 0.5% cash to buy food, food, 0.5% more money for drugs treatment and 1.4% for travel (2006-2008). The demand for clothing, education, shopping furniture, houses shrink from 0.2 to 0.7%, though always poor groups enjoyed many exemptions policy of the State.
